Capri Holdings Limited’s Q3 2025 Earnings Call: Insights and Impacts

On February 5, 2025, Capri Holdings Limited (CPRI) held its Q3 2025 earnings call, shedding light on the financial performance of the luxury fashion powerhouse. The call was led by Jennifer Davis, Vice President of Investor Relations, with Chairman and CEO, John D. Idol, and Thomas J. Sullivan, Executive Vice President and CFO, in attendance.

Financial Highlights

During the call, Capri Holdings reported a 10.2% increase in net sales for the quarter, reaching $1.7 billion. The company’s gross profit margin grew by 1.3 percentage points, amounting to 61.1%. Net income for the quarter was reported at $255.8 million, a significant improvement from the $179.1 million reported in the same quarter the previous year.

Strategic Initiatives

Idol shared updates on the company’s strategic initiatives, including its focus on digital growth. Capri Holdings has continued to invest in its digital capabilities, with online sales up by 25% year-over-year. Idol also mentioned the successful launch of its VERSO brand, which has already gained traction in the market.
